Concept: How about selfadjusting game-mechanics, that identifiy high profile targets and allows a BH, who got this target to join up with some of his BH friends ?
- BH terminal gives no information about a mark, but keeps track of the outcome of the mission. Instead of the current way of mission issue, the bounty hunter gets a non-tradable ingame item (datapad or so) which decribes the target roughly (i.e. is it a jedi, apvp ranked,or a smuggler, and which faction the mark is) in addition this datapad provides information on the maximal size of the Bounty Hunter group, the total payout, and the consequences of dropping or failing the mission.
- From the BH side there are 3 scenario how the mission ends:
* he(or the group) wins, mark gets killed
* he drops the mission, because the mark appears to be to strong =>bounty bail is put on his head
(twice as highasfor getting killed during the fight)
* he gets killed during a fight with the target => single bounty bail because of failure - From the Mark side its also 3 scenario:
* he wins => the BH engine recognises the Makr as a high profile target
* he escapes => the BH engine recognises this and scores it as a moderate profile target
* he gets killed => removal from the term - If a target kills the BHs in more than
twoone (due to the fact that PC-hunting is shifted to the MBH box, and BHs will become quite rare again) BH attacks, the mission becomes flagged forphase2 - If a target escapes the BHs in more than
fivethree BH attacks, the mission becomes flagged for phase2
Phase2-Targets:
- If a BH gets a mission for a phase2 flagged target, the mission data pad offers an option for group forming, starting with a groupsize of 2
- The BH can use this option to invite other BHs (or alternatively non-BH-player, if they are willing to step into BH business, i.e. facing the risk of getting on the BH term for failure), depending on the round, he can use this option manyfold depending on the maximal group size, to build his BH group. Total mission payout of such missions is much higher and split amongst the group members, if the maximal group size is reached the payout per BH is less than for a single BH mission, but if the BH decides to do the mission with less then the maximal group, these missions become pretty much the money maker.
- All invited BHs must stay in the group till the mission is completed, the BHs are killed or mission is aborted. Killed BHs get kicked out of the group and get single bail punishment.
- If the multiperson missions are aborted, the bail put on the group memberswill be higher than for single BHmissions, the punishment for getting killed will stay the same. If BHs leave the group, they are punished by the higher bail (double than getting killed) also.
- If the target still manages to survive the group attack several times, then the maximal group size is increased again, thus nobody has to worry about balancing BH vs Jedi or BH vs rest of the world, anymore. The game-mechanics ensure that the target is confronted with a BH group matching the targets abilities, sooner or later ....
- A mission can get issued multiple times, but the target is blocked by the first BH attacking it for 10 minutes, thus avoiding exploits of the new system.
- (Optional) There should be an additionalmechanism, that allows the phase2 mark to bribe an BH NPCs for taking him from the terminal, after he has succeeded the first round of attacks (by doing a quest in Jabbas Palace or Nyms, it should be tedious, so only the ones that are really devoted to it and sick of getting hunted, should be able to do it). The option for starting the quest is available at the BH terminal for high profile targets only as long as the target is not given outto a BH.So there is only a short time frame from the last BH encounter till the mission gets issued again. Once the quest is enabeled from the term, the target has one hour of time to do the quest. If the target succeeds in doing the quest, his profile is reset, he is taken from the term.
